TRANSPORT LINKS

Railway Street is less than a five-minute drive from the A5 south of Norton Canes and Junction T6 of the M6 Toll Road at Burntwood. These makes journeys to Birmingham, Cannock, Lichfield and Stafford very easy.

For trains, a twenty-minute drive (naturally longer by bus) to Lichfield provides access to two main train stations. These are Lichfield City and Lichfield Trent Valley train station, with the latter offering fabulous commuting links due to its split-level platform for the West Coast Mainline and the Cross City Line. This means there are regular services to Birmingham, Sutton Coldfield and Redditch as well as national routes to London, Liverpool, Manchester and even the occasional Glasgow service. Train services to Birmingham are also available from Cannock via the Chase Line, which is closer to the home.

Bus users will be delighted that the Cannock to Lichfield service passes nearby along Burntwood Road.
